Personal injury law permits a person to receive compensation for injuries wrongfully inflicted upon them by another. The law defines negligence as either (1) the failure to do something which a reasonably careful person would do or (2) the doing of something which a reasonably careful person would not do under similar circumstances. Common causes of personal injury cases include: automobile accidents, construction injuries, slips and falls, medical malpractice, and faulty products. The common example is that a patient enters a hospital to have surgery done on a part of his/her body and comes out of surgery with conditions that they did not arrive with. For example, a patient enters a hospital to have the right leg removed and due to negligence the left one is removed instead. A medical negligence claims can also stem from a misdiagnosis of an illness, failure to treat a condition according to currently accepted standards in medical treatment and, very often, negligence in administering anesthesia. Hospitals are responsible for their employees' negligence, but the facility itself isn't always liable for medical malpractice that occurs in the treatment setting. To justify an award of compensation a Quebec medical malpractice lawyer must prove negligence and thereafter show that the patient was damaged by the negligent act as opposed to injury caused by a progressive underlying illness. Proof of these matters depends on evidence usually in the form of specialist independent medical reports which are produced to the court dealing with the matter. To show negligence it is necessary to prove that the treatment is below the standard of that which is achievable by a reasonable competent healthcare practitioner operating under similar circumstances.

Suits against government-operated hospitals and their employees are governed by the Colorado Government Immunity Act and must satisfy the requirements set out in that statute, including statutory notice given to the hospital within 180 days of the negligent care. These lawsuits are best handled by counsel experienced with a CGIA claim.

Just as motorists have a duty to obey the rules of the road and keep a proper lookout for other drivers, so do health care professionals such as doctors, dentists, podiatrists, chiropractors, psychiatrists, nurses, and hospitals have an obligation to perform their duties in accordance with the prevailing standard of care in their community and in their specialty. Establishing this duty of care usually requires expert testimony by another medical professional. If a defendant can prove that the plaintiff failed to exercise due care for his or her own protection, and that this failure was a contributing cause to plaintiff's injuries, a few jurisdictions will recognize this contributory negligence as a complete defense. Under this defense the plaintiff's conduct is found to fall below a level reasonable for his or her own protection. For example, suppose that a fast-food restaurant serves its coffee at a dangerously high temperature but does not inform its customers that their coffee is considerably hotter than other restaurants or that customers have often been burned by coffee spills. A drive-through customer who is burned in a careless attempt to open the lid with his teeth while driving in traffic may be found to have demonstrated a lack of due care (i.e., he is negligent, too). Moreover, if that failure is found to contribute to plaintiff's injuries, some states' laws would deny any recovery to plaintiff.
